PSG, once considered a mediocre team, has risen to prominence since being acquired by Qatar Sports Investments in 2011, injecting billions into the club and attracting superstars like Zlatan Ibrahimović, David Beckham, Lionel Messi, Neymar and Kylian Mbappé.
Despite dominating the French league (Ligue 1) with 11 titles in 14 seasons, PSG has yet to win a Champions League title, coming close in 2020 but losing to Bayern Munich.
PSG's transformation includes a shift from relying on individual superstars to a more team-oriented approach under coach Luis Enrique, emphasizing young, tenacious talent.
Inter Milan, a member of soccer's old guard, has won three European championships, most recently in 2010, and is known for its sturdy defense and cohesive teamwork.
Key players to watch include PSG's Khvicha Kvaratskhelia and Ousmane Dembele, and Inter's Lautaro Martínez, all striving to win their first Champions League title.
Expert predictions favor PSG due to their impressive offense and unique style of play under Luis Enrique.

Paris Saint-Germain's journey to the final has been marked by significant investment and a shift in team dynamics. Under new management, the team has moved away from a reliance on individual brilliance to a more cohesive, tactical approach. This transformation has seen them overcome challenges and emerge as a formidable force in Europe.
Inter Milan, on the other hand, brings a wealth of experience and a tradition of success to the final. Their strong defense and organized play have been key to their advancement in the tournament. Despite narrowly missing out on the Serie A title, Inter's focus is now set on conquering Europe.
The final will be a fascinating clash of tactical styles. PSG's attack-minded approach, led by dynamic players, will test Inter's solid defense. Inter's ability to counter and capitalize on opportunities will be crucial in disrupting PSG's rhythm.
Luis Enrique's vision for PSG involves a unique style of play that aims to catch opponents off guard. Meanwhile, Inter's Simone Inzaghi emphasizes teamwork, intensity, and determination.

The match will be broadcast on CBS and Paramount+ at 3 p.m. ET. Coverage begins earlier in the day on CBS Sports Golazo Network with pre- and post-match analysis.
What time is the Champions League final?
The match is scheduled for 3 p.m. ET on Saturday.
Where is the Champions League final being held?
The final will take place at Allianz Arena in Munich, Germany.
Which teams are playing in the final?
Paris Saint-Germain (PSG) and Inter Milan are competing for the title.
How can I watch the Champions League final?
The game will be broadcast on CBS and streamed on Paramount+.
